This is an incredible signed Majestic New York Yankees jersey autographed by Derek Jeter, one of the most iconic players in baseball history. The signature is beautifully placed on the front of the jersey in bold ink, making it a standout piece for any Yankees fan or serious collector.

What makes this piece even more special is the detailed inscription commemorating Jeter’s historic 2000th hit, which reads “2000th Hit Yankee Stadium Pitcher: Scott Elarton Kansas City Royals May 26th, 2006.” This adds significant historical value and ties the jersey directly to one of Jeter’s major career milestones. In addition, the jersey is limited edition numbered 01/22, making it an extremely rare and desirable collectible.

The jersey itself is a classic Majestic Yankees pinstripe jersey and presents exceptionally well, perfect for framing or display.

This item has been authenticated by AAC and includes their Certificate of Authenticity, as well as a hologram affixed to the piece, ensuring the signature and inscription are 100% genuine.
